随着互联网的普及和发展,越来越多的企业和个人开始建立自己的网站,而PHP作为一种广泛使用的服务器端脚本语言,已经成为了网站开发的主流技术之一,本文将为您介绍PHP网站的开发流程和基础知识,帮助您快速入门PHP网站开发。

一、PHP简介

PHP(Hypertext Preprocessor,超文本预处理器)是一种开源的通用计算机脚本语言,尤其适用于Web开发并可嵌入HTML,PHP语法借鉴了C、Java和Perl等编程语言,易于学习和使用,PHP的主要特点是跨平台、易于部署、功能强大、安全性高。

二、PHP环境搭建

要进行PHP网站开发,首先需要搭建一个PHP运行环境,这里推荐使用XAMPP(Apache+MySQL+PHP+PERL)集成环境,它是一个将Apache服务器、MySQL数据库、PHP环境和PERL语言打包在一起的免费软件包。

1、下载XAMPP安装包:访问XAMPP官网(),根据您的操作系统选择相应的安装包下载。

2、安装XAMPP:运行下载的安装包,按照提示进行安装,在安装过程中,建议勾选“Install for All Users”(为所有用户安装)和“Add to SendTo”(添加到发送到菜单),以便快速启动XAMPP。

3、启动XAMPP:安装完成后,点击桌面上的XAMPP图标启动Apache服务器、MySQL数据库和PHP环境,启动成功后,浏览器输入“”即可看到XAMPP的欢迎页面。

三、编写第一个PHP程序

1、创建一个新的文本文件,将其命名为“hello.php”。

2、用文本编辑器打开hello.php文件,输入以下代码:

<?php
echo "Hello, World!";
?>

3、将hello.php文件保存到XAMPP安装目录下的“htdocs”文件夹中。

4、在浏览器中输入“”,即可看到显示“Hello, World!”的页面。

四、PHP基本语法

1、PHP标签:所有的PHP代码都需要在“<?php”和“?>”之间书写,这是PHP的基本语法规则,用于区分HTML代码和PHP代码。

2、输出内容:使用echo语句可以输出内容,echo "Hello, World!"

3、变量:在PHP中,可以使用变量来存储数据,变量名以$符号开头,$name = "张三";

4、数据类型:PHP支持多种数据类型,如整数(int)、浮点数(float)、字符串(string)、布尔值(bool)等,$age = 25;表示一个整数类型的变量。

5、运算符:PHP支持多种运算符,如算术运算符(+、-、*、/等)、比较运算符(==、!=、>、<6. 条件语句:PHP支持if、else if和else条件语句,if ($age >= 18) { echo "成年"; } else { echo "未成年"; }

7、循环语句:PHP支持for、while和do-while循环语句,for ($i = 0; $i < 10; $i++) { echo $i; }

8、函数:PHP支持自定义函数和内置函数,function sayHello($name) { echo "Hello, " . $name; }

五、PHP与MySQL数据库交互

1、连接数据库:使用mysqli_connect()函数连接到MySQL数据库,$conn = mysqli_connect("localhost", "root", "", "test");

2、执行SQL语句:使用mysqli_query()函数执行SQL语句,$result = mysqli_query($conn, "SELECT * FROM users");

3、获取查询结果:使用mysqli_fetch_assoc()函数获取查询结果集,while ($row = mysqli_fetch_assoc($result)) { echo $row["name"]; }

4、关闭数据库连接:使用mysqli_close()函数关闭数据库连接,mysqli_close($conn);

PHP网站开发入门指南

通过以上内容,您已经掌握了PHP网站开发的基础知识和技能,接下来,您可以学习更多的PHP特性和技巧,如面向对象编程、文件操作、错误处理等,进一步提升您的PHP网站开发能力,祝您学习愉快!